calypsonian
/kælɪpˈsɒnɪən/Definitions
1. noun
A person who composes, performs, or sings calypso songs, typically in the Caribbean or of Caribbean origin.
“The calypsonian’s energetic performance at the festival was met with thunderous applause from the crowd.”
2. noun
A composer or singer of calypso music, especially in the Trinidad and Tobago Carnival.
“The calypsonian’s witty lyrics captured the essence of the carnival season.”
